We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Audit Supervisor to join their assurance team. This role is responsible for supervising attest engagements, including audits, reviews, and compilations, while ensuring quality standards and regulatory compliance are met. The ideal candidate will have strong technical skills, a client-focused mindset, and the ability to lead junior staff effectively.

Key Responsibilities:
Lead day-to-day operations of attest engagements (audits, reviews, compilations, and agreed-upon procedures).
Supervise and mentor junior and senior associates during fieldwork and throughout the engagement cycle.
Review workpapers and draft financial statements to ensure compliance with professional standards (GAAS, SSARS, and other relevant frameworks).
Identify and resolve accounting and audit issues with guidance from managers or partners as needed.
Serve as a primary point of contact for clients during engagements to coordinate requests and deliverables.
Assist with engagement planning and scheduling, ensuring adherence to budgets and deadlines.
Participate in staff training, development, and performance evaluations.
Qualifications:
CPA preferred or CPA-eligible.
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or related field.
3–5 years of public accounting experience, with a focus on attest/audit engagements.
Solid understanding of U.S. GAAP, GAAS, SSARS, and other applicable standards.
Excellent organizational, analytical, and communication skills.
Experience with engagement software (e.g., CaseWare, CCH Engagement, or similar platforms) is a plus.
